Output 740f1c1d6b0af538e069460a23d50d2a74147be6829193155d1ae0bf2a6f9d24:0

value
1868505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a17bce958726d6127466c43bc4b4ca3dacdc4e90 OP_EQUAL
address
3GQs2gpuw8o4BdXysz6ysytA7iPfhzhtWi
transaction
740f1c1d6b0af538e069460a23d50d2a74147be6829193155d1ae0bf2a6f9d24
confirmations
253232
spent
true